yo barry,

go to google type in touch dev click on the wiki article. go to "decrypt firmwire" and find the 1.1.1 version, go to the link and it will download. from there, you can put it on your desktop. If it is automatically unzipped, right click and click "make archive" it will appear as a zip file on the desktop. right click > get info. click name and delete .zip and put .ipsw

there will now be a cube looking icon on your desktop. go to itunes, click alt + restore and let go. click on 1.1.1 ipsw on the desktop, and it will extract it.
